    UPVC is a low-conductor of heat

    Unplasticized polyvinyl chloride (UPVC) is an easy-to-maintain building material. It is a great option for homes in areas that experience unpredictable weather because of its durability. UPVC is also an excellent insulation material that helps to maintain the temperature of the home.

    Another reason to think about uPVC is its fire-repellent properties. PVC is a fire retardant because of its chlorine content. This makes it an ideal material for windows. In addition, an UPVC door or window can help cut down on energy costs by capturing heat.

    UPVC in conjunction with double-glazed glass, can improve the effectiveness and efficiency of homes' heating and cooling systems. This technology is especially useful in colder climates.

    UPVC windows help to slow the spread of fire

    If you're considering installing new windows and doors in your home it is important to consider the fire-safety implications of the materials you pick. uPVC is the ideal material to protect against fire. It is a non-flammable material because of its high chlorine content. However, it also comes with the additional benefit of being resistant to mould and pollution.

    It isn't as simple as other plastics to ignite, which has been proved. It is approved to be used in a variety of rigid applications, such as doors and window frames.

    uPVC is also resistant to moisture and water and is easy to clean. This makes it a popular option for homeowners. UPVC is available in a variety styles and colors so that you can pick the ideal product for your property.

    Despite its strength, uPVC is not as robust as aluminium, and could fail in the event of a fire. A window that is weak or damaged could result in increased smoke and fire spread into an apartment. That is why the requirement for fire ratings is often a prerequisite in the construction of many buildings.

    The primary function of uPVC is its resistance against ignition. The chlorine in uPVC assists in keeping it non-flammable. Once the source of the ignition is eliminated then the uPVC frame ceases to burn and prevents the window from spreading the flame.

    UPVC windows are produced in large quantities

    UPVC windows are made in window factories. There are a variety of designs and styles available based on the manufacturer. Usually, these are super airtight, and super robust. They are resistant to rain and weather, and also colorfast and termite-resistant.

    The first step in the manufacturing process of uPVC windows is to produce a uPVC resin. To increase its durability and performance the resin is mixed up with various chemicals and additives. It is also tested to determine its quality.

    After the resin is created, it is then heated to a high temperature. The molten resin is finally forced through the mold. When it's released it's a long section of a frame. As the profile cools, it becomes more pliable to work with.

    When the profiles are complete they are then cooled before being cut to the desired length. Fittings are then put into the uPVC window frame. It is essential to install uPVC windows that have extreme sensitivity when they are glass pane windows.

    Other components of windows can be constructed in addition to the frames. This includes the cylinders for windows and doors as along with hinges and fittings. These parts have a significant impact on the price and quality.

    Window frames are then joined together with the help of heat-based welding. Galvanized steel or aluminium reinforcements are inserted into the frames to increase the strength of the frames.

    The raw materials must be carefully selected to ensure top quality of the final product. They are then blended in the exact proportion of chemicals. This gives the window white index, UV resistance and other properties.
